To investigate the operative method of repairing soft tissue defect of finger with modified reverse dorsal digital fascia flap and its cl inical effect of preventing and treating venous crisis. Methods From February 2005 to March 2007, 19 cases (22 fingers) with soft tissue defect of finger were treated, including 14 males (17 fingers) and 5 females (5 fingers) aged 2-62 years old (median 26 years old). There were 8 cases of cutting injury, 6 cases of crush injury, 4 cases of avulsion injury, and 1 case of hot crush injury, involving 3 thumbs, 7 index fingers, 6 middle fingers, 4 ring fingers and 2 l ittle fingers. The size of soft tissue defect was 1.5 cm × 0.8 cm-5.5 cm × 1.5 cm, and the time from injury to operation was 2-11 hours(average 7 hours). The axis of flaps was the l ine of transverse striation of fingers via dominant artery. The flaps were deflected dorsally, as “b” or “d”, to cover the wounds. Reverse dorsal digital fascia flaps 1.8 cm × 1.0 cm-6.0 cm × 2.0 cm in size were adopted to repair the defects. The donor site underwent skin grafting fixation. Results All flaps survived, without venous crisis and obvious swollen. The grafted skin in the donor site all survived. All patients were followed for 6-18 months (average 11 months). Postoperatively, color and texture of the grafted flaps were similar to that of normal skin, and the pulp of the fingers was normal. The two-point discrimination was 8-11 mm, and the activities of interphalangeal joint of all injured fingers were normal. Conclusion The modified reverse dorsal digital fascia flap is ideal for repairing soft tissues defects of the fingers, and can decrease the occurrence of venous crisis.

Objective To investigate the application of arm medial fascio-cutaneous flap pedicled with cutaneous nerve and nutrient vessel. Methods From February 1999 to December 2004, 18 cases of skin and soft tissue defect in axillary region, elbow and forearm were treated with arm medial fascio-cutaneous flap pedicled with cutaneous nerve and nutrient vessel. Arm medial fascio-cutaneous flap was directly transferred in 3 cases, adversely transferred in 15 cases. The flap area was 4.5 cm×8.5 cm. Results Vein circulation crisis was observed in 3 cases. Of the3 cases, 1 was necrosis and the other 2 by decompressing small vein were saved.The rest 15 cases survived.The period of follow-up was 3 to 30 months. Flap was satisfactory in appearance and function. Conclusion Arm medial fascio-cutaneous flap pedicled withcutaneous nerve and nutrient vessels can be directly or adversely transferred to repair adjacent soft tissue defect.
Objective To introduce the application of the scrotal flap on reconstructing partial urethra defect. Methods From March 1998 to August 2004, 31 patients with urethra defect were treated with scrotal flap. Their ages ranged from6 to 34 years. Thirty-one patients included 8 cases of congenital deformity of urethra and 23 cases of complication of urethral fistula, urethral stenosis and phallus bend after hypospadias repair. The flap widths were 1. 2. cm in child and 2.3. cm in adult. The flap lengthwas 1. -2.0 times as much as the width. Nine cases were classified as penile type, 10 cases as penoscrotal type, 7 cases as scrotal type(3 children in association withcleft scrotum) and -cases as perrineal type because of pseudohermaphroditism.Urethroplasty was given by scrotal fascia vascular net flap to reconstruct urethra defect. Results All the flaps survived, and the incision healed well. Twenty four cases achieved healing by first intention and 7 cases by second intention. And fistula occurred and healed after 2 weeks in 1 case. 27 cases were followed up 14 years, 2 cases had slight chordee, the others were satisfactivly. Conclusion Urethroplasty with scrotal fascia vascular net flap is an ideal method for the partial defect urethra.
Objective To investigate the cl inical outcome of a surgical strategy by soft tissue expansion in treating acquired auricular defect. Methods Between January 2007 and December 2009, 136 patients with acquired auricular defect were treated with a surgical strategy by putting autoallergic costal framework after soft tissue expansion. There were 93 males and 43 females, aged 8-60 years (median, 20 years). Defects were caused by burn in 82 cases, by trauma in 47 cases, and by bite in 7 cases. Defect involved in almost the whole auricle and earlobe in 50 patients, 2/3 superior part of auricle in 35 patients, 1/3 superior part of auricle in 31 patients, 1/3 middle part of auricle in 9 patients, and 1/3 inferior part of auricle and earlobe in 11 patients. Results All the flaps had good blood supply, skin grafts all survived, and all the wounds healed by first intention after operation. All patients were followed up 6-24 months with an average of 14 months. All reconstructive auricle survived with good color, soft texture, and normal sensory function; the appearance had no enlargement and attrition, and the grafted costal cartilage framework had no malacosis, absorption, and deformation. The reconstructed ear had the same position, size, shape, and oto-cranium angle as normal ear. The curative effect was good according to ZHUANG Hongxing’s evaluation standard of auricular reconstruction. Conclusion To reconstruct auricle by soft tissue expansion is an effective method. The position of putting expander and the number of expanders are different in different patients.
Objective To study the biological characteristic and potential of chondrocytes grafting cultured on fascia in repairing large defect of articular cartilage in rabbits. Methods Chondrocytes of young rabbits were isolated and subcultured on fascia. The large defect of articular cartilage was repaired by grafts of freeze-preserved and fresh chondrocytes cultured on fascia, and free chondrocytes respectively; the biological characteristic and metabolism were evaluated bymacroscopic, histological and immunohistochemical observations, autoradiography method and the measurement of nitric oxide content 6, 12, 24 weeks after grafting. Results The chondrocytes cultured on fascia maintained normal growth feature and metabolism, and there was no damage to chondrocytes after cryopreservation; the repaired cartilage was similar to the normal cartilage in cellular morphology and biological characteristics. Conclusion Chondrocytes could be cultured normally on fascia, which could be used as an ideal carrier of chondrocytes.
Objective To investigate the method and the curative effect of postauricular muscular fasciae-periosteal flap and modified unwrinkle incision in parotidectomy. Methods From January 2006 to August 2008, 28 patients with benign lesions of parotid gland were treated. There were 17 males and 11 females aged 19 to 79 years old (average 50 years old),including 20 cases of mixed tumor, 5 cases of adenolymphoma, 1 case of branchial cleft cyst, 1 case of eosinophil ic hyperplastic lymphogranuloma, and 1 case of myoepithel ioma. Tumor masses were all prominent, with the diameter of 2.4-3.8 cm and partial-tough texture. The course of disease was 3-18 months (average 9.5 months). Parotid gland and tumor mass were resected with postauricular incision hidden within the hairl ine, introcession defect (3.0 cm × 2.0 cm × 1.0 cm-3.5 cm × 2.5 cm × 1.5 cm) were repaired with simultaneouly adopting postauricular muscular fasciae-periosteal flap (4.0 cm × 3.0 cm × 1.0 cm-5.0 cm × 4.0 cm × 1.5 cm) by turning the pedicle flap 180°. Results All incision healed by first intention and no necrosis of postauricular muscular fasciae-periosteal flap occurred. All patients were followed up for 6-24 months (average 12 months). The incision was hidden within postauricular hairl ine and shape of parotid realm was good. No sal ivary fistula, facial paralysis, and earlobe numbness occurred. No Frey syndrome were found by local iodine-starch tests. Conclusion Because of hidden incision, good repair effect of region introcession deformity, and fewer postoperative compl ications, the modified parotidectomy with postauricular muscular fasciae-periosteal flap and modified unwrinkle incision is a better method in parotidectomy.
